Trends in the properties of group-15 elements | The p-block Elements | Chemistry | Khan Academy

Description In this video, we will quickly discuss the trends in the atomic properties, discuss the physical characteristics of the elements and their oxidation states. Timestamps 00:45 - Stability of half filled configurations. 02:15 - Consequence of the stability of half filled configurations. 02:52 - Trends in the covalent radius 03:15 - Trends in the ionisation energy and electronegativity 03:35 - Physical characteristics 04:38 - Oxidation states Practice this concept - https://www.khanacademy.org/science/i...
